Buying A Property For The First Time In Bangalore

As a first time home buyer, you are likely to be both excited and somewhat jittery about buying your first home. A city like Bangalore offers several options for both first time home buyers and others in terms of choice and amenities. Buying a home is often a life-time commitment and almost all of the other choices in life will remain closely tied to this very decision.

Buying a home is a long-term financial commitment and people need to be aware of the implications it is likely to have on their monthly finances. Adequate provisions need to be made for the EMIs, taxes and other frequent home expenses. Also, we are seeing a relative drop in the average age of the modern home buyer. In most cases, nowadays people in the 30-40 age ground find it attractive to make a decision on investing in a home.

This relatively, inexperienced home buying profile, often results in hurried transactions, executed with inadequate planning which can land you in a difficult spot. The decision to buy a home can be enriching and reward, if executed with sufficient planning, advice and thought. However, the same can turn out to be a nightmare, ...
... if done so, in a hurried and ill-advised manner.

Given the pitfalls in a real estate transaction and possibility of making a mistake, it is advisable to stick to a reputed and well known developer. This relatively cuts down the risk but does not eliminate it altogether. At the same time, a home buyer must be clear about what exactly he wants from the home. With the myriad choices currently available, it is very easy to get confused and buy something which you will have little use in future.

Carrying out a thorough research is also vital. The research must include legal scrutiny, financial advisory and conversations with existing or potential buyers. Taking this approach is likely to keep you insulated from a lot of potential risks in the future.
